Factors to Consider for Cat Tree Clearance
Choosing the right cat tree involves thought about several important factors. Each detail matters to ensure my furry friends, like my White Ragdoll cat, Milo, get the best experience possible.
Size and Height of the Cat Tree
Size and height play a huge role in how a cat tree fits into your home. A tall tree offers more climbing options, which keeps cats like Milo entertained and active. Most cats enjoy climbing, and a study in the Journal of Feline Medicine and Surgery shows that vertical space can reduce stress and promote healthy behavior in cats. If your home has limited space, opt for a compact model that still provides height.
Material and Durability
Material matters a lot when picking a cat tree. Durable materials like pressed wood or sturdy MDF can withstand rough play and scratching. I once bought a cat tree made of cheaper materials, and it fell apart within months—Milo wasn’t too happy about that! Plus, safer, non-toxic materials ensure my pet’s health. Look for trees with removable, washable covers to keep everything fresh and clean.
Tips for Successful Cat Tree Clearance
Finding the right cat tree during clearance sales can be exciting. I know how important it is to create the perfect space for my Ragdoll, Milo.
Organizing Your Space
Start by measuring your available space. That helps narrow down choices and avoid clutter. I once got a cat tree too big for my living room, and it didn’t fit anywhere!
Next, consider your cat’s favorite activities. If Milo loves climbing, I’d prioritize height. If lounging is more his style, I’d look for wider bases with comfy resting places.
Finally, make sure the cat tree doesn’t block pathways. You want an organized home, not an obstacle course. Clear areas around the tree, so Milo can get to it easily.
Choosing the Right Cat Tree
Select sturdy materials that will last. I learned this the hard way when an inexpensive tree broke after a few weeks! Look for cat trees made from solid wood or quality pressed cardboard.
Check the height of the tree. Taller trees can help keep indoor cats active and mentally stimulated. A study by the American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als (ASPCA) showed that enriched environments reduce stress in cats.
Don’t forget to assess the scratching surfaces. Milo loves to scratch, and having sisal-covered posts can keep him entertained while saving my furniture! Opt for designs that cater to your cat’s habits to ensure they use it.
